What is Home Is Where the Bodies Are about?
Home Is Where the Bodies Are delves into the intricate dynamics of family relationships and concealed truths as three estranged siblings reunite following their mother’s passing. Beth, Nicole, and Michael find themselves drawn into a web of mystery when they uncover a chilling secret hidden within their parents’ home videos—a revelation that challenges their perceptions of their family’s history. As they navigate through past and present, the siblings confront their own demons while unraveling the truth behind their father’s mysterious actions, culminating in a suspenseful journey of guilt, forgiveness, and redemption. Home Is Where the Bodies Are by Jeneva Rose Book Summary & Synopsis

From New York Times bestselling author of The Perfect Marriage and You Shouldn’t Have Come Here, comes a chilling family thriller about the (sometimes literal) skeletons in the closet.
 
After their mother passes, three estranged siblings reunite to sort out her estate.
 
Beth, the oldest, never left home. She stayed with her mom, caring for her until the very end.
 
Nicole, the middle child, has been kept at arm’s length due to her ongoing battle with a serious drug addiction.
 
Michael, the youngest, lives out of state and hasn’t been back to their small Wisconsin town since their father ran out on them seven years before.
 
While going through their parent’s belongings, the siblings stumble upon a collection of home videos and decide to revisit those happier memories. However, the nostalgia is cut short when one of the VHS tapes reveals a night back in 1999 that none of them have any recollection of. On screen, their father appears covered in blood. What follows is a dead body and a pact between their parents to get rid of it, before the video abruptly ends. Beth, Nicole, and Michael must now decide whether to leave the past in the past or uncover the dark secret their mother took to her grave.

Exploring the Shadows

In Jeneva Rose’s tantalizing thriller, “Home Is Where the Bodies Are,” readers are plunged into a world where secrets lurk in every shadow and danger lies just beneath the surface. Set against the backdrop of a tranquil small town, the novel follows the three siblings Beth, Micheal, and Nicole, as they embarks on a harrowing journey to uncover the truth behind their haunting past. With its intricate plot and dynamic characters, Rose weaves a narrative that is as chilling as it is captivating, leaving readers spellbound until the final revelation.

Crafting a narrative that grips readers from the first page to the last, “Home Is Where the Bodies Are” by Jeneva Rose delves into the intricate web of family dynamics and hidden truths, delivering a captivating mystery thriller that leaves readers on the edge of their seats.

As the story unfolds, we are introduced to three estranged siblings who are brought back together following the passing of their mother. Beth, the steadfast eldest sibling, has remained in their childhood home, dedicated to caring for their mother until her final moments. Meanwhile, Nicole, the middle child, grapples with the demons of addiction, kept at arm’s length from her family. Lastly, Michael, the youngest, has distanced himself from their small Wisconsin town ever since their father’s sudden departure seven years prior.

Amidst the solemn task of sorting through their mother’s belongings, the siblings stumble upon a trove of home videos, unwittingly unearthing a dark secret buried in the past. The revelation of a night captured on a VHS tape from 1999 propels them into a labyrinth of mystery and intrigue, challenging their perceptions of their family history. Rose skillfully intertwines past and present timelines, weaving a narrative that keeps readers eagerly turning the pages.

The characters in “Home Is Where the Bodies Are” are richly drawn, each grappling with their own personal struggles while navigating the complexities of their shared past. Beth’s unwavering loyalty, Nicole’s battle with addiction, and Michael’s emotional distance lend depth and authenticity to their interactions, immersing readers in their emotional journey.

Throughout the novel, Rose masterfully crafts a suspenseful plot filled with unexpected twists and turns, leading to a climactic conclusion that ties up all loose ends. The pacing is relentless, driving the narrative forward as readers race to uncover the truth behind the family’s buried secrets.

More than just a gripping thriller, “Home Is Where the Bodies Are” delves into themes of guilt, forgiveness, and redemption, exploring how the past shapes the present and influences future decisions. Rose’s writing is immersive and engaging, drawing readers into the heart of the small town where dark secrets lurk beneath the surface.

While the novel’s flashback segments are filled with enjoyable pop culture references, they may occasionally feel heavy-handed. Nevertheless, this minor flaw does not detract from the overall strength of the story.

“Home Is Where the Bodies Are” is a compelling read that seamlessly blends suspense with emotional depth.
